
【版本控制】
文章平均质量分 67
种下星星的日子
用代码书写人生,尽在我的CSDN,欢迎大家访问!
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
如何将idea项目上传到Git
Git是一款免费的分布式版本控制工具。每个人的电脑都是一个完整的版本库,那么我们该如何将一个java项目上传到Git呢?一、准备工作1、Git下载及安装https://jingyan.baidu.com/article/7f766dafba84f04101e1d0b0.html2、GitHub注册账号https://github.com/3、idea上创建java项目二、配置idea项目1、配置id原创 2017-11-16 12:05:23 · 41245 阅读 · 81 评论 -
Git简单使用
Git简单使用: 提交,更新,解决冲突一、提交先同步,检查没有冲突后,再commit and push二、更新先sys,检查没有冲突后,再pull,拉取一下三、解决冲突找到冲突文件,使用Merge Tool,合并,手动修改代码,修改后Add to Git Index总结:Git和SVN的使用还是有区别嘀原创 2017-11-16 12:07:16 · 255 阅读 · 10 评论 -
Git与SVN,选哪个好?
Git与SVN,我们应该选用哪个好?首先我们来看一下具体他们有什么不同之处。Git分布式,而SVN集中式:SVN: SVN属于集中化的版本控制系统,必须联网才能工作。有个不太精确的比喻:SVN = 版本控制+ 备份服务器,SVN支持并行读写文件,支持代码的版本化管理,功能包括取出、导入、更新、分支、改名、还原、合并等。大都采用图形界面操作,直观,上手快。 Git: Git是一原创 2017-11-02 14:19:49 · 2469 阅读 · 17 评论 -
SVN小知识
一、SVN是什么?SVN是Subversion的简称,是一个开放源代码的版本控制系统,相较于RCS、CVS,它采用了分支管理系统,它的设计目标就是取代CVS。互联网上很多版本控制服务已从CVS迁移到Subversion。说得简单一点SVN就是用于多个人共同开发同一个项目,共用资源的目的。二、功能svn可以将你每一次的修改内容,差异进行统计。你也可以随时恢复到你想回去的相应版本(即你修改原创 2016-05-22 19:08:23 · 746 阅读 · 38 评论 -
【Git】配置SSH-key到GitHub
背景: 今天从github上clone,出错,报的是key有问题,到github上看了看果然是因为SSH-key失效。配置步骤: 一、生成SSH Key 1、首先查看本机是否安装SSH,在终端输入ssh即可: 2、输入ssh-keygen -t rsa,生成key,然后连续按回车键三次(注意:千万不要输入密码!) 出现上面内容就说明成功生成id_rsa和id_rsa.pub两...原创 2018-04-30 11:28:54 · 417 阅读 · 8 评论 -
【Git】如何更新或取消GitHub上fork的Repository
GitHub gitHub是一个面向开源及私有软件项目的托管平台,因为只支持git 作为唯一的版本库格式进行托管,故名gitHub。 gitHub于2008年4月10日正式上线,除了git代码仓库托管及基本的 Web管理界面以外,还提供了订阅、讨论组、...原创 2018-05-05 11:02:53 · 2547 阅读 · 45 评论